Nominal Effective Exchange Rate Index
Nominal Effective Exchange Rate Index data was reported at 101.564 2010=100 in 2018. This records an increase from the previous number of 99.575 2010=100 for 2017. Nominal Effective Exchange Rate Index data is updated yearly, averaging 100.000 2010=100 from Dec 2000 (Median) to 2018, with 19 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 103.446 2010=100 in 2009 and a record low of 95.797 2010=100 in 2001. Real Effective Exchange Rate Index
Real Effective Exchange Rate Index data was reported at 102.773 2010=100 in 2018. This records an increase from the previous number of 100.843 2010=100 for 2017. Real Effective Exchange Rate Index data is updated yearly, averaging 100.843 2010=100 from Dec 2000 (Median) to 2018, with 19 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 103.916 2010=100 in 2004 and a record low of 98.311 2010=100 in 2015. Real effective exchange rate is the nominal effective exchange rate (a measure of the value of a currency against a weighted average of several foreign currencies) divided by a price deflator or index of costs.
